Dual-socket 1U rack server

The Dell PowerEdge R640 is a 1U rack server built for dense scale-out data centre computing. It ships with two Intel Xeon Gold 6142 processors, each running at 2.6 GHz with 16 cores. The system includes 256 GB of DDR4 registered ECC memory across 24 slots. Redundant 750 W platinum power supplies and a front bezel with rails are included.

Suits virtualisation hosts needing maximum core

This configuration suits virtualisation hosts and compute clusters that need 32 total cores and 256 GB of DDR4 memory in a single rack unit. The PERC H730P controller supports RAID 0, 1, 5, 6, 10, 50 and 60 with a 2 GB cache. Buyers who need more than two processors or require 3.5-inch drive bays should look elsewhere.

256 GB DDR4 registered ECC memory across 24 DIMM

The installed 256 GB of DDR4 2666 MHz registered ECC memory occupies eight of the 24 available slots. This leaves 16 slots free for expansion up to the 3 TB maximum capacity. The memory type and slot count are the decisive factors when planning future upgrades or validating compatibility with existing modules.

Questions about this item

How long will the H730P controller battery last before it needs replacing?

The PERC H730P includes a 2 GB battery-backed cache; the battery typically lasts several years and can be swapped without removing the controller.

What limits sustained CPU performance in this 1U chassis?

Dual Xeon Gold 6142 processors share a 750 W redundant power budget, so thermal headroom in the 1U form factor is the first constraint under continuous load.

How loud and hot does the server get when running 24/7?

Redundant 750 W Platinum supplies and high-speed 1U fans keep components cool, but expect noticeable fan noise and warm exhaust air during all-day operation.
